Transaction 270831805385c5ecdcd16c1510baf65011b0896c4d24dea7a4f3d58268d5a1c4
1 Input
1 Output
-
270831805385c5ecdcd16c1510baf65011b0896c4d24dea7a4f3d58268d5a1c4:0
- value
- 17200
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f62e86bc7027e6a195b0a8981c26b1bc769cb95bd35dcd300c6d27e710bab75a
- address
- tb1p7chgd0rsyln2r9ds4zvpcf43h3mfew2m6dwu6vqvd5n7wy96kadqhvpndp